noun
Meaning 1
A form of imperfect rhyme in which the final (coda) consonants of stressed syllables (and, in modern English poetry, any following syllables to the end of the words) are identical in sound, but the vowels of the stressed syllables are not.

Meaning relationships
Synonyms: near rhyme, quasi-rhyme, slant rhyme
Antonyms: exact rhyme, full rhyme, perfect rhyme
Broader terms: imperfect rhyme, rhyme, concord
